Accelerated Technologies Holding Corporation, (OTC PINK: ATHC), Announces Letter of Intent to Acquire Food Importer and Distributor For $4,000,000

179 43 Merci

NEW YORK, NY / ACCESSWIRE / January 18, 2022 / Accelerated Technologies Holding Corporation. (the “Company” or “Accelerated”) (OTC PINK:ATHC). ATHC is a FinTech holding company that provides business services for SMB’s and owns and operates disruptive technologies products in the sectors of artificial intelligence, short-term alternative funding platforms, electronic payment solutions, social engagement, health, and wellness solutions, is pleased to announce a letter of intent to acquire a company with exclusive importation rights, distribution, and sales of food and beverage products. The intended strategic acquisition will fast-track ATHC’s deployment of its ROMPOS small business solution while adding in excess of five million ($5,000,000) in annual revenue. The significant bottom line will propel Accelerated Technologies to profitability. As part of the non-disclosure agreement, ATHC may only refer to the acquisition target as “Food Distributor Network”.

The Food Distributor Network is a New York-based privately held importer and distributor of specialty foods and beverages. Established in 2009, the network distributes to approximately 550 small businesses throughout the United States with the heaviest concentration in New York City. The Food Distributor Network demonstrated stable annual growth and 2021 annual sales of approximately $5,000,000. ATHC intends to utilize its own ROMPOS platform to enhance revenues and dramatically increase the current bottom line of approximately $500,000 EBITDA. In addition, ATHC will launch several sites to further generate revenues, digitize operational mandates to eliminate inefficiencies while expanding sales to generate significant additional revenues.

The letter of intent contemplates the issuance of 3,200,000 common shares as consideration for the acquisition at a deemed price of $1.25 per share. Accelerated Technologies will acquire all shares (100%) of the Food Distributor Network. The transaction is subject to adjustment based upon revenue and stock performance criteria, and to certain conditions, including further completion of due diligence and the negotiation and execution of a formal purchase and sale agreement ( the “Agreement”), receipt of applicable approvals, and standard closing conditions before May 15th, 2022.

The 2020 revenues of $4,682,578 exceeded previous Food Distribution Network’s projections by $653,321, approximately 15%. Respectively, the net income of $388,356 exceeded the projection by approximately 10% gaining $33,541 for the year. The Network’s final numbers for 2021 are projected to be 10% higher.

This acquisition affords ATHC to gain revenue from additional verticals by launching on-demand delivery, launching B2C retail specialty websites with cryptocurrency as payment options, and additional marketing for the Food Distribution Network. ATHC’s ROMPOS will optimize internal workflow to significantly propel revenues and respective EBITDA. ATHC intends to deploy offerings to the Network’s existing clients. In managements discussions and beliefs, 15% of Food Distribution Network’s client base will utilize ROMPOS, Kash OnDemand, and Shieldmost. Upon success, ATHC stands to gain additional revenues upwards of $3,000,000 annually. ATHC’s management believes upon completion of the acquisition, combined year-end revenues are projected to exceed $10,000,000 for 2022.

Post Q1, 2022, issuance to debenture investors and 3,200,000 shares as consideration for the acquisition, the total issued and outstanding will adjust to approximately 19,000,000 shares. ATHC anticipates revenue of approximately $0.53 per share and EBITDA of $0.15 respectively.
